China's Zhao Xintong became the first player from Asia to win the World Snooker Championship with an 18-12 victory over Mark Williams of Wales at the Crucible Theatre in Sheffield, England.
The 28-year-old is the first amateur and just the third qualifier to lift the trophy since the event moved to his current home in 1977. His achievement lifted him to 11th in the world rankings.
